コンテンツにスキップ

ネットワーク

プロキシとカスタム証明書を構成します。

OpenCode は、エンタープライズ ネットワーク環境の標準プロキシ環境変数とカスタム証明書をサポートしています。


プロキシ

OpenCode は標準のプロキシ環境変数を尊重します。

Terminal window
# HTTPS proxy (recommended)
export HTTPS_PROXY=https://proxy.example.com:8080
# HTTP proxy (if HTTPS not available)
export HTTP_PROXY=http://proxy.example.com:8080
# Bypass proxy for local server (required)
export NO_PROXY=localhost,127.0.0.1

CLI flags を使用して、サーバーのポートとホスト名を構成できます。


認証する

プロキシで基本認証が必要な場合は、URL に資格情報を含めます。

Terminal window
export HTTPS_PROXY=http://username:password@proxy.example.com:8080

NTLM や Kerberos などの高度な認証を必要とするプロキシの場合は、認証方法をサポートする LLM ゲートウェイの使用を検討してください。


カスタム証明書

企業が HTTPS 接続にカスタム CA を使用している場合は、それらを信頼するように OpenCode を構成します。

Terminal window
export NODE_EXTRA_CA_CERTS=/path/to/ca-cert.pem

これは、プロキシ接続と直接 API アクセスの両方で機能します。